AyahBiomorph [Pod, Anthropomorphic]The Ayah pod is a relatively common type of pod that refers to a collective varying different pod types, all of them sharing a few things in common. The first of the various pods to be called an "Ayah" emerged on Mars during the early Interstellar period, where they were piloted as a way to help raise children and train children, to make up for a shortage of teachers and educators. Although it's likely the first true Ayah emerged on Earth and was involved in healthcare fields, especially taking care of elderly and infirm patients. In any situation, the Ayah pod is a pod that is ideal for taking care of patients, and are often found as live-in assistants, au pairs, daycare workers, healthcare providers, and the like.
Even into the present, Ayah pods are almost always female, and are almost always designed with pleasant but not particularly striking looks. As they're pods, the seams where they were grown and then pieced together are usually visible, since no effort is made to hide what they are. However, all of the traits that make Ayah special are "under the hood," so to speak. They feature an enhanced sense of smell, allowing them to be aware of the emotional state of their charges at all times, while also incorporating an air-based sonar and extended, ultrasonic hearing that allows them to see directly into the body of their war. The infravision, allowing them to detect temperature, and even have oxygen storage, so they can survive brief periods of decompression so they can save their wards. Their pleasant voices are designed to be soothing and calming, and their body language and posture is designed so that they are non-confrontational. AGIs and AIs that are installed into an Ayah are usually trained to have a positive bedside manner, and generally have a good awareness of first aid and a variety of different medical procedures and treatments. Lastly, their acute hearing and their sharp sense of taste and smell allows them to detect noises and chemicals others might miss, while their modified joints and muscle tissue is enhanced, making them much stronger than they would outwardly appear to be. Most Ayah are capable of lifting and carrying a fully-grown adult human with minimal effort. Ayah pods are popular with aged gerontocrats, many of whom suffer from degenerative conditions that modern science still finds difficult, if not impossible, to completely cure. The average demesne of an gerontocrat will usually have a small staff of Ayah working away, either helping to take care of them or caring for the extended family, well into the great-great-grandkids and the great-great-great grandkids. Ayah Variants and FAmily
The Ayah is a relatively little-known pod with a highly specialized function. As a result, there aren't many variants and alterations on the Ayah, and any that do exist are likely to be local variants rather than Verge-wide alterations.

The Ayah is a weird situation where the android type tends to be more common than the pod variant. It's likely the pod developed out of the android, and it's only been recently that the android type has caught on. Ayah androids have a very distinctive psychological profile that makes then more attuned to their job.
